Nats' Dukes leaves with knee injury
2008-07-05 21:47:00
Cincinnati, OH (Sports Network) - Washington Nationals left fielder Elijah Dukes left Saturday's contest against the Cincinnati Reds in the seventh inning after twisting the patella bone in his right knee.

Yankees hang on to upend Boston behind Mussina's strong outing
2008-07-05 20:49:00
Bronx, NY (Sports Network) - Mike Mussina hurled six scoreless innings, and New York survived a late scare to clip Boston, 2-1, in the third installment of a four-game series from Yankee Stadium.

Ankiel's heroics lead Cards past Cubs
2008-07-05 19:19:00
St. Louis, MO (Sports Network) - Rick Ankiel stroked a game-winning two-run single in the ninth and hit a solo home run in the sixth, as the St. Louis Cardinals got three runs in the ninth to beat the Chicago Cubs, 5-4, in the middle contest of a three game set at Busch Stadium.
